description Product Description
Used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ceutical compounds, particularly in the development of central nervous system (CNS) agents. Its piperidine core with a hydroxy and thiophene substituent makes it valuable in medicinal chemistry for constructing bioactive molecules. The tert-butyl carbamate (Boc) group protects the nitrogen during peptide or heterocyclic synthesis, allowing selective reactions at other sites. It is employed in research settings to design ligands for neurological receptors, including those targeted in treatments for depression, anxiety, and neurodegenerative diseases. Also utilized in creating novel analogs for structure-activity relationship (SAR) studies due to its stereochemical and electronic properties.
